#1 3 years ago

I have a Gottlieb Card Whiz that if not for the "ball gate" issue, the pin operates 100%.
Trough,runway and EX switches are cleaned and gaped properly.
Resistance at the coil reads 15.
When the ball rolls over the lane guide on the right hand side, the gate opens as it should
but then immediately closes so the coil is not staying energized.
Any help would be greatly appreciated.

#4 3 years ago
Quoted from MarkG:

Sounds like a problem with one of the three switches in the lock in circuit.
[quoted image]
What about the switch on the P/Add Player Unit relay?
/Mark

Normal closed switch at "P" was open, adjusted and it works perfect now.
Thanks for the advice.
